Washington, D.C.—Today, U.S. Representative Wesley Bell (D-Mo.) introduced the Public Safety and Mental Health Reporting Act, legislation aimed at increasing transparency and improving public safety through comprehensive data collection on interactions between law enforcement officers and individuals with mental illness. This introduction comes during Mental Health Awareness Month, underscoring the urgent need to better understand and address how mental health intersects with public safety.

Washington, D.C.— Today, Representative Wesley Bell (D-Mo.) announced that the City of St. Louis has been awarded $4,902,750 through the Federal Aviation Administration’s Airport Infrastructure Grants (AIG) program. This funding will support the design phase of a new public-use deicing pad and containment facility at St. Louis Lambert International Airport.

Today, Representatives Wesley Bell (D-Mo.) and Gus Bilirakis (R-Fla.) introduced a bipartisan resolution recognizing April as Parkinson’s Awareness Month. The resolution honors the more than one million Americans living with Parkinson’s disease and calls for increased public awareness, federal research investment, and support for individuals and families affected by the condition.
WASHINGTON D.C. – This week, Representatives Wesley Bell (D-Mo.), Jahana Hayes (D-Conn.), and LaMonica McIver (D-N.J.) introduced the Safer Neighborhoods Gun Buyback Act, which would invest $360 million in grant funding to establish state and local gun buyback programs to help prevent gun violence, remove unwanted firearms from communities nationwide and empower local safety efforts.
